Random vibration analysis of the F-2 nanosatellite structure ○Thuong Nguyen Van・Hung Nguyen Viet・Khanh Nguyen Phu・Tuan Le Anh(HUST) SANE2013-95 |

A random vibration analysis of a Nanosatellite structure in the launch phase is presented in this paper. The objective of this study is to assure the structural integrity of the components in order to survive the launching loads. The structural dynamics analysis was performed using ANSYS software for a finite element model of the chosen satellite. The Finite Element Analysis (FEA) showed the resistance of the satellite components during the launch. These FEA results are important for the satellite structure design team to check the design and make the necessary changes before the physical vibration testing. |
